DETERMINATION OF RARE EARTH ELEMENTS IN GEOLOGICAL SAMPLE BY PRE-GROUP SEPARATION ON-NEUTRON ACTIVATION ANALYSIS

  • Thirteen rare earth elements in geological sample are determined by neutronactivation analysis. The sample is decomposed by acid. The interfernceelements such as Fe, Sc, Cr, U and Th are removed by Topo-cyclohexaneextraction. The rare earth elements are separated and concentrated by passingthrough D_2EHPA-Kel-F Column. After irradiating the concentrate in reactor for20 hours and waiting for some time, the γ-spectra of activated rare earth elementsare measured by program control Ge (Li) γ-spectrometer. The precision of methodless than ±15%. The recovery of the separation process is more than 90%.
